492 Scent of Possibility
Fragrance notes
Character
Neroli and bergamot spark immediately, then aldehydes lift the citrus into a bright, slightly soapy shimmer. Jasmine and gardenia carry the heart with a creamy weight, though the lemon blossom and lily-of-the-valley keep the white floral accord from feeling heavy. Sandalwood grounds the flowers without dulling them, and the white musk lingers well after the first spray has settled into skin. The scent stays near the body rather than announcing itself across a room, which suits a fragrance built for sunlit mornings and open windows. It holds through a full day of movement and air, so the wearer does not have to think about it again once it is on.
The aldehydes give 492 Scent of Possibility a crisp, polished edge that feels clean and modern. It suits someone who wants a floral that reads fresh rather than romantic, and it works as easily with a linen shirt as with a tailored jacket. The limitation sits in the blend itself. The lemon blossom and neroli are vivid but thin, so the composition never develops much depth or shadow. It smells pleasant and composed, yet it does not change or surprise as the hours pass. Anyone hoping for a white floral with dark corners or a shifting personality will find this one too straight and transparent.
